自动线的使用经验表明,化费在换刀上的时间可达自动线总停机时间的45%。缩短时间损失的途径之一就是进行成组换刀。恢复自动线工作能力所需要的时间取决于换刀方式和同时换刀的数目。而每一组刀具的数目又决定换刀所需时间。 一组刀具数目的最佳方案应该是使自动线达到最高的使用效率。在确定成组换刀的经济效果时,必须考虑到不可修复的废品和可修复的废品上的耗费,寻找报废刀具的耗费,以及在排除可能发生意外情况的后果方面由于占用了一部分工作时间的耗费。因此停车概率取决于工作时间的增量和分布的积分函数。
